How much do art administrator j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 30, 2026, the average hourly pay for art administrator in the United States is $23.60,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$16.11 and $25.96 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is an art administrator?

Art Administrators are professionals who manage the business and organizational aspects of art institutions such as galleries, museums, theaters, and cultural organizations. Their duties include coordinating exhibitions, managing budgets, overseeing staff, organizing events, and ensuring smooth day-to-day operations. Art Administrators serve as a bridge between artists, the public, and the institution, ensuring that artistic programs are executed effectively. They play a vital role in promoting the arts and supporting the creative community.

How does an art administrator typically collaborate with curators and artists on exhibition planning?

Art Administrators play a key role in coordinating between curators, artists, and other stakeholders to ensure smooth execution of exhibitions. They handle logistics such as scheduling, budgeting, and contract management, while also facilitating clear communication to align creative and operational goals. By working closely with curators on exhibition themes and with artists on installation needs, Art Administrators help maintain timelines and resolve challenges that may arise during planning and setup.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an art administrator,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Art Administrator, you need strong organizational abilities, knowledge of art history or arts management, and often a relevant degree such as in arts administration or management. Familiarity with budgeting software, gallery management systems, and event planning tools is typically required. Excellent communication, problem-solving, and interpersonal skills help build relationships with artists, patrons, and stakeholders. These skills ensure effective coordination of art programs, successful event execution, and the smooth operation of arts organizations.

What is the difference between Art Administrator vs Art Coordinator?

AspectArt AdministratorArt Coordinator
Required CredentialsBachelor's degree in arts administration, arts management, or related fieldBachelor's degree in arts, communications, or related field
Work EnvironmentArt galleries, museums, arts organizationsArt projects, exhibitions, events coordination
Employer & Industry UsageUsed in arts organizations managing operationsUsed in event planning and project management in arts

Art Administrators focus on managing the overall operations of arts organizations, including budgeting and policy, while Art Coordinators handle the logistics and execution of specific projects or exhibitions. Both roles require similar educational backgrounds but differ in scope and daily responsibilities.

Job description

The Opportunity: We are seeking to hire an Expressive Arts Administrator. Under the supervision of the Clinical Services Manager, the Expressive Arts Administrator provides individual and group art therapy services to individuals with severe and persistent mental illness. The Expressive Arts Administrator integrates evidence-based art therapy interventions into Intensive Treatment Services programming, including Art Therapy, Day Treatment, and substance use disorder/intensive outpatient programs. This position also leads the planning and coordination of the agency’s annual Art of Recovery event in collaboration with the Director of Marketing and Development.

What You’ll Do:

  • Develop and facilitate therapeutic groups that integrate art therapy interventions and address the clinical needs, treatment goals, and levels of care of individuals participating in Intensive Treatment Services.
  • Provide individual counseling and art therapy services to assigned clients within the employee’s credentials, scope of practice, and demonstrated competencies.
  • Complete assessments of prospective participants to determine their appropriateness for Art Therapy programming and identify other applicable treatment options based on assessed needs and level of care.
  • Complete timely, accurate, and clinically appropriate documentation, including progress notes, assessments, and treatment plans, in accordance with agency policies, regulatory requirements, and applicable billing standards.
  • Participate in treatment planning and regularly reviews and updates clients’ goals, objectives, interventions, and progress
  • Collaborate with members of the interdisciplinary treatment team to coordinate services and support continuity of care.
  • Provide supervision and guidance to art therapy interns and, as assigned, other art, music, or recreational therapy staff.
  • Manage the Art Therapy Program’s supplies, including maintaining inventory, identifying program needs, and ordering materials within the approved budget.
  • Maintain a safe, organized, and therapeutic environment for individual and group services.
  • Procure, present, and maintain submitted artwork for the agency’s annual Art of Recovery event.
  • Collaborate with the Director of Marketing and Development on the planning and execution of the agency's annual Art of Recovery.
  • Perform other duties as assigned

About Us:  For over 35 years, Community Support Services has been making a difference in the lives of countless individuals with severe and persistent mental illnesses. Our nearly 300 employees are real-life champions committed to quality treatment, collaborative care, and effective outcomes. Located in downtown Akron, Ohio, we serve as a leader in behavioral health care for the entire Summit County area.

What We’re Looking For:

  • An appropriate combination of education, training, course work and experience may qualify an applicant to demonstrate required knowledge, skills, and abilities. 
    • An example of an acceptable qualification is: Master’s degree in Counseling, Social Work, or Art Therapy, other closely related field, and three to five years of experience working with persons with severe and persistent mental illness.
  • Current State motor vehicle operator’s license.
  • Registered Art Therapist (ATR), Licensed Independent Social Worker (LISW) or Licensed Professional Clinical Counselor (LPCC) preferred.
